Abstract

Aim: This study aims to describe the various concerns and treatment strategies associated with the polycystic ovarian syndrome. Polycystic syndrome of ovaries is the most prevalent endocrine problem in adult women and is distinguished by anovulation, excess androgen, and the involvement of ultrasound polycystic ovaries. Hirsutism, obesity, miscarriage, and menstrual irregularities are the signs that are particularly troubling for patients. The hypothesis describes that PCOS is a systemic disease reinforced by recent discoveries amplifying hormones and cytokines in muscle mass tissue. Result and discussion: The treatment strategy should be adapted to the patient's phenotype, problems, and willingness to replicate. Infertility care centers on treatments for activation of ovulation and may include medications, such as metformin, letrozole, clomiphene, and gonadotropin. The application of oral contraception and the adjuvant application of anti-androgens also includes the management of hirsutism. For both treatments of infertility and long-term management, weight loss in obese women with PCOS can be helpful. Conclusion: The literature survey concluded that the proper diagnosis and treatment of PCOS are important; otherwise, it cannot be adequately controlled and can cause many metabolic disorders and other health-related risks.
